Kvm qxl driver windows

Kvm qemu windows guest drivers virtiowin this repository contains kvm qemu windows guest drivers, for both paravirtual and emulated hardware. However, things seem to be coming together, albeit slowly. Will a faster gpu help with qxl performance not doing passthrough im running a windows 10 vm with with the qxl driver and id like to increase video performance. Running windows 10 on linux using kvm with vga passthrough. I will not be able to use lookingglass without a windows 7 driver. In this article, i am going to show you how to install windows on kvmqemu virtual machines that uses virtio storage, network and qxl vga card. It is now a valuable resource for people who want to make the most. I began the process of adding lookingglass to my existing setup today. Actually, i linked to the incorrect guide the point i was trying to make was that its important that you install the virtio drivers in a specified order. One final observation is to do with the windows version number.

How do you install the virtio hdd drivers for kvm on. Just putting resolved the issue on intel nehalem make sure you have two cdrom drives for windows installation. Hi all, where can i found qxl driver for windows 2012 r2windows 8. Im trying to install windows server 2012 r2 on a debian kvm host, but it does not seem to find the drivers. This section contains various optional drivers and daemons that can be installed on the guest to provide enhanced spice integration and performance. Driver isos each of the isos is labelled with a numeric release. The virtio package supports block storage devices and network interface controllers. Fedora cannot ship windows virtio drivers because they cannot be.

Fedora cannot ship windows virtio drivers because they cannot be built automatically as part of fedoras build. This bit depends on whether you are installing a new windows vm or you already have an. Some time ago i wrote a post about the use of new virtio video driver for a kvm guest with a debian 8 operative system. Windows qxl driver is not needed if you are using the windows guest tools installer above. Where the f is the illusive virtiogpu windows driver. Right click on the display adapters microsoft basic display adapter and click on update driver. This includes the qxl video driver and the spice guest agent for copy and paste, automatic resolution switching. After starting the ivshmem server and booting qemu windows 7 cannot see any new hardware for. This document describes how to obtain virtio drivers and additional software agents for windows virtual machines running on kernelbased virtual machines kvm. Installing windows 10 guest on kvm with virtio lsal. Drivers should be signed for windows 64bit platforms. In this step, we would create the windows 10 vm in kvm virtualization environment step by step. This is a main page for the windows guests drivers.

I have no idea why only windows 10 is leaking out through the qxl driver, but whatever is going on appears to be in the kernel. Kvm qemu based windows 10 vm step by step april 2, 2020 6 min read. Now you need to create a new disk image, which will force windows to search for the driver. The only drivers i see for storage are for windows server 2008, and 2008 r2. Code signing drivers for the windows 64bit platforms. I succesfully installed other operating systems including windows server 2008 and windows 8. Virtio drivers are kvms paravirtualized device drivers, available for windows guest virtual machines running on kvm hosts. How to boot windows partition virtually under kvm with. If not, connect it by clicking connect and set the image location to the according windows 10. Virtio drivers are paravirtualized device drivers for kvm virtual machines. Delete directories with find and exclude other directories. This lag i speak of with windows x does not exist here, not even a little bit. The qxl display driver is also included in the virtio windows driver iso file that youve downloaded.

Windows qxl driver is not needed if you are using the windows guest tools. The vm runs fine but it is quite laggy, expecially when dragging windows around or writing something in the browser. Installing virtio drivers in windows on kvm zeta systems. Discussion created by evilryry on apr 19, 2019 latest reply on apr 24. This is not needed if you are using the windows guest tools installer above. The virtiowin drivers are not provided as inbox drivers in microsofts windows installation kit, so installation of a windows guest on a virtiowin storage device viostorvirtioscsi requires that you provide the appropriate driver during the. Kvm qemu based windows 10 vm step by step dennis notes.

The plan is to have a guest gpu that is fully independent of the host gpu. Windows 7 pro guest is now stable with all the redhat drivers. Xda developers was founded by developers, for developers. Installation of kvm qxl display drivers for windows 10. Help with virtio drivers for a windows 10 vm vm engine. Now, click on browse my computer for driver software.

Ive recently rebuilt a windows7 guest but using qxl and spice. Redhats qxl windows 8 driver works with windows 10. The performance of the microsoft driver is not too bad but it means no resizing which is annoying. In this note i describe how i setup windows 10 on a kernelbased virtual machine kvm using qemu. Virtio drivers for virtualbox question user need to manually install virtio drivers on windows guests using drivers from driver download page or prebuilt driver iso from fedora projec.

Well use the virtio storage and network windows drivers later. I am trying to install windows 7 64bit as a kvm guest. I am hoping that the spice people make their drivers and installer work soon. During the past few days ive been tring to setup a virtual machine to run windows 10 with qemukvm, because i dont have a gpu to passtrough i set it up to use qxl with spice. The screen resolution can now be changed although autoscaling doesnt work. In this video, i follow up from the last video on running windows 10 within kvm qemu and show how to install the qxl graphics drivers as well. The tutorial uses a technology called vga passthrough also referred to as gpu passthrough or vfio for the vfio driver used which provides nearnative graphics performance in the vm. I dont see inside lateststable iso images from fedoraproject thanks. If your distribution does not provide binary drivers for windows, you can use the package from the fedora project. For this reason i can only run windows 7 and not windows 10.

Im using windows 7 guest on fedora 29 host, and qemukvm. The kvm virtio drivers are automatically loaded and installed on the following. Windows 2008 r2 standard kvm guest is stable with all 61. I use virtinstall to start my installation from the command li. By default, the virtiowinlatest repository is disabled and virtiowinstable repo is enabled.

However, it is not designed to offer nearbare metal performance. The driver install instructions seem to be for performing within the windows environment, using file explorer, i cant actually install windows. Windows binaries windows guest tools spiceguesttools s. Paravirtualized drivers enhance the performance of machines, decreasing io latency and increasing throughput to near baremetal levels. There is an issue about cpu model with windows 10 as a kvm guest. The best way to install and setup a windows 10 vm as a. This is a video driver that improves performance and. When booting a windows guest that uses virtiowin devices, the relevant virtiowin device drivers must already be installed on this guest. Virgil is a research project to investigate the possibility of creating a virtual 3d gpu for use inside qemu virtual machines, that allows the guest operating system to use the capabilities of the host gpu to accelerate 3d rendering. Now, select the virtio driver cd and click on next. The code builds and ships as part of the virtiowin rpm on fedora and red hat enterprise linux, and the binaries are also available in the form of distributionneutral iso and vfd images. I read here that i should install the virtio scsi driver during installation.

For reasons which dont seem to be explained, the qxl video driver is not compatible with windows 8. Sometimes the windows img youve selected in the initial setup isnt correctly connected. The qxl drivers are not in the iso image but unpacked to usrsharevirtio but the qxl driver is signed. I downloaded the rpm file linked below and used the qxldod driver for windows 8. How to install virtio drivers on kvmqemu windows virtual. My hardware does not support vtd, however it supports vtx, and i found. Kvm qxl windows driver download drivers svidetelstvo. I have no plans to do gpu passthrough at this time. Creating windows virtual machines using virtio drivers fedora. I created a virtio hdd in virtmanager, and connected the driver iso from here. In this video, i follow up from the last video on running windows 10 within kvmqemu and show how to install the qxl graphics drivers as well as exploring how to enable portable storage from the. Why cant i see a qxl device in my windows 10 kvm guest. These drivers are digitally signed, and will work on 64bit versions of windows.

In this approach i use the virtual machine manager gui, but everything can be done via terminal terminal, too. Older versions could still be useful when, as it happens, a windows vm shows instability or incompatibility with the latest drivers. It found the driver, red hat virtio scsi controller, packaged by canonical, ltd but could not find the disk. Subreddit for the qemukvmlibvirt virtualization stack. You have to tell windows to use the netkvm driver from the driver image. Creating windows virtual machines using virtio drivers. If you try to install windows guest tool, qxl wddm dod driver wont. As you can see, the display adapter is recognized as red hat qxl controller. I read that the resolution of a windows server 2012 installed in a virtual machine virtmanager,libvirt,kvm,qemu can be improved by using spice.

784 990 1487 1488 633 974 934 1346 1157 1066 720 1459 801 444 443 1121 1429 1513 218 708 870 644 1284 1116 974 808 1305 447 1265 191 1269 415 236 130